I have heard there are issues using "%zu" format specifier on
Windows/mingw, because mingw links against a very old Windows library
that does not support the C99 standard.
I have also heard that this isn't an issue anymore because of
__USE_MINGW_ANSI_STDIO in wxWidgets.
I tried to reproduce this problem on my Windows 10 machine but couldn't
-- using %zu works fine.
Does anyone know if this is still a problem on any of our supported
platforms?
